When printing, elements that stretch to viewport height or whose height is specified as a percentage relative to the viewport have their heights computed relative to the WebView’s height. Often, such as when the WebView fills an entire browser window that takes up the entire height of the screen, those elements become taller than a page. One example, as in the URL, is the html and body elements in a quirks-mode document. Patch (with cross-platform changes and fix for Mac) forthcoming
